Buhari congratulates ARISE NEWS on 10th anniversary
President Muhammadu Buhari on Thursday congratulated the owners and management of Arise News Channel on their 10th anniversary, commending them for their efforts in ridding Nigeria of colonial mindset and promoting pride for the nation’s heritage.
The Senior Special Assistant to the President on Media and Publicity, Garba Shehu, in a statement in Abuja, cited President Buhari to have declared: “I pay my respects to Arise News on this historic occasion, marking a proud chapter in the development of broadcasting in the country.
“I urge you to not just give news but also mould the thinking of our people to appreciate the positive developments brought about under the aegis of the Change agenda of our administration. The media should continue to lead the way in transforming society.”
